A Oh, yes.

i Q What would be those differences?

--*&'**,. • Weil, first of all, with respect to elevation,

soils are generally found in lower

elevations, much lower elevations than the Brunswick

Shale formation area.

The soil in the glacial lake area which can

generally be referred to as the Parsippany Silt Loam,

have a lower permeability and exhibit a high water table

and generally is not suitable for residential development,

particularly development with septic systems for sewerage

disposal. 'i

The Brunswick Shale soils, we have found t6 he '•'•

very, very variable. They are generally very shallow,

to bedrock. Permeability of these soils varies considerably

from one location to another and we occasionally have a

high seasonal water table in those areas.

Q When you say "high seasonal water table, "

can you be anymore precise about the depth to water table?

[Id say generally, when I speak of a high

;er table, I am referring to a water table

having a depth — oh, withint two to three feet of the

surface of the ground, during the wet seasons of the year,

generally, late winter, early spring.

Q All right. The floodways and floodplains

are indicated as two areas which are not suitable for on-

site disposal.

A That is correct.

Q In addition, I believe this paragraph also

addresses other land characteristics which are also viewed

as being unsuitable for steep slopes. Excuse me, for

on-site disposal of septic sanitary waste. Is that

correct?

A Steep slopes and subsurface conditions? Subsurface

conditions being soil permeability and ground watfer and

so forth? -•'••$

Q In what manner do steep slopes constitute

impediments of disposal of sewerage waste?

A Well, steep slopes, first of all, cause construction

of on-site disposal systems to be very expensive. Number

two, there is an increase in risk of the effluent flowing

through the soil and breaking out to the surface of the

slope.\ ' -•--.-' -Vfl • . • •- • ?•'-,'.

&*-..,- '-.§te p slopes are generally, also, associated with

.ow* &ep%h to bedrock, although not always so that

frequently, it is a factor where steep slopes are involved.

Considerable amount of excavation and filling is generally

required, where one attempts to put a septic system on a

steep slope.

Q In that third paragraph, Page 2, the sentence

'•"- fcpgears "Spray disposal tends to reduce some of those

Specifically what problems does spray disposal

tend to reduce, do you know?

A Well, one of the problems in treating effluent

into the stream, is that it still contains phosphates

and nitrates, possible nitrites, that cause problems,

particularly in small streams. The problems that are

caused, these compounds are essentially fertilizers

and growths of aquatic vegetation.

One of the primary problems that has existed in

many areas, has been the rapid growth, uncontrolled growth

of algae.

By using spray irrigation, we could eliminate,

to some extent, the problem of phosphates going into the

receiving waters. The nitrate problem would be reduced

but, certainly not eliminated.
